
Iranian regime henchmen transferred political prisoner Latif Hassani on Thursday, June 26th, from Tabriz Prison to Tehran’s notorious Evin Prison, while he has been on hunger strike since May 18th, protesting human rights violations against inmates.
He was arrested in February 2013 along with a number of other political activists in Iran’s Azerbaijan region on charges of propaganda against the state. He was later sentenced to nine years in prison.
The wife of this political prisoner has said Latif Hassani will continue his hunger strike until he is transferred to the political war in Gohardasht Prison or Evin. This inmate is now currently being held in Evin’s quarantine section.
